In the dynamic world of logistics and supply chain management, the warehouse serves as a crucial node for receiving, storing, and distributing goods. Efficient warehouse management is paramount to maintaining inventory accuracy, optimizing storage space, and ensuring smooth order fulfillment. To equip professionals with the necessary knowledge and skills, this comprehensive training guide delves into the core aspects of warehouse management.

1. Warehouse Design and Layout

The design and layout of a warehouse significantly impact its functionality and efficiency. This section covers essential considerations such as warehouse types, space allocation, aisle configuration, and equipment selection. Participants learn how to optimize warehouse layout to facilitate efficient product flow, reduce congestion, and maximize storage capacity.

2. Inventory Management Techniques

Inventory management is the cornerstone of effective warehouse operations. This section introduces inventory control systems, including FIFO, LIFO, and ABC analysis. Participants learn how to calculate inventory levels, set minimum and maximum stock levels, and implement inventory control strategies to ensure optimal stock replenishment and minimize waste.

3. Receiving and Put-Away Processes

The receiving process involves receiving goods from suppliers and verifying their accuracy. Participants learn about receiving procedures, documentation requirements, and quality control measures. This section also covers put-away processes, including strategies for efficient product placement and storage optimization.

4. Order Fulfillment and Shipping

Order fulfillment is the process of selecting, packaging, and shipping customer orders accurately and efficiently. This section covers order processing procedures, picking strategies, and packing methods. Participants learn how to optimize order fulfillment processes to reduce errors, minimize lead times, and enhance customer satisfaction.

5. Warehouse Management Systems (WMS)

Warehouse management systems (WMS) play a vital role in automating and streamlining warehouse operations. This section introduces the benefits and capabilities of WMS, including inventory tracking, order management, and reporting. Participants learn how to evaluate and select a WMS that meets the specific requirements of their warehouse.

6. Warehouse Safety and Compliance

Ensuring a safe and compliant warehouse environment is critical. This section covers warehouse safety regulations, including OSHA and ANSI standards. Participants learn about hazard identification, risk assessment, and accident prevention measures. Additionally, they explore compliance requirements related to product handling, storage, and documentation.

7. Performance Metrics and Key Performance Indicators (KPIs)

Measuring and evaluating warehouse performance is essential for continuous improvement. This section introduces key performance indicators (KPIs) used to assess warehouse efficiency, including inventory accuracy, order fulfillment rates, and space utilization. Participants learn how to track and analyze KPIs to identify areas for improvement.

8. Warehouse Staff Training and Development

A well-trained and motivated workforce is essential for warehouse productivity and accuracy. This section covers strategies for developing and implementing effective staff training programs. Participants learn about job-specific training, safety training, and continuous professional development opportunities.

9. Cost-Effective Warehouse Management Strategies

Optimizing warehouse operations while minimizing costs is a constant challenge. This section introduces strategies for reducing warehouse costs, including space optimization, inventory control techniques, and efficient material handling practices. Participants learn how to identify cost-saving opportunities and implement effective cost reduction measures.

10. Best Practices and Emerging Trends

The warehouse management industry is constantly evolving. This section explores emerging trends and best practices, such as the use of automation, robotics, and data analytics. Participants gain insights into innovative technologies and strategies that can enhance warehouse efficiency and productivity.
